Algeria Launches Traveling Quran Recitation Caravan Across Mascara Province
……………..
Algeria’s Ministry of Religious Affairs and Endowments, in collaboration with the Mascara Provincial Office of Tourism and Handicrafts, has initiated a traveling Quran recitation caravan. Launched on July 11 under the theme “The Light of the Quran Guides Us and the Memory of the Free Is Our Commitment,” the caravan began at the Imam Muslim Mosque in Mascara city.
Renowned Algerian reciters, including Abdelaziz Sahim, Abdelkarim Belhassen, and Abdelmonem Baroudi, performed during the event. Over three days, the caravan will visit mosques in multiple towns such as El Kharroub, Ghriss, Tighenif, and others, featuring ten reciters from across Algeria.
Besides Quranic recitations, the program includes religious activities like ibtihal by students from local Quranic schools and zawiyas, alongside lectures on Quran memorization led by mosque officials. The initiative will culminate with a closing ceremony, honoring the reciters and young Quran memorizers aged 9 to 14.
